BLEEK, WILHELM HEINRICH IMMANUEL (_son of Friedrich Bleek of Berlin,
biblical critic 1793–1859_). _b._ Berlin 8 March 1827; ed. at Bonn
and Berlin; studied habits and language of the Kaffirs in Natal
1855–57; interpreter to Sir George Grey at Cape Town 1857;
librarian of the valuable collection of rare books presented by
Sir G. Grey to the colony at Cape Town 1 Feb. 1862 to death;
granted civil list pension of £150, 18 June 1870. (_m._ Jemima
Charlotte, she was granted a civil list pension of £100, 13 June
1877); author of _The languages of Mozambique_ 1856; _The library
of Sir George Grey 2 vols._ 1858–59; _Comparative grammar of South
African languages_, _2 parts_ 1862–69; _Reynard the Fox in South
Africa, or Hottentot tales and fables_ 1864; _Bushman folklore_
1875. _d._ Cape Town 17 Aug. 1875. _Cape Monthly Mag. xi_, 167–69
(1875).
BLENKINS, WILLIAM BAZETT GOODWIN. Captain 6 Bombay native infantry
26 April 1842 to death; C.B. 4 July 1843. _d._ Bombay 12 June
1852.
BLENKIRON, WILLIAM (_son of Mr. Blenkiron of Marrick near Richmond,
Yorkshire, farmer_). _b._ Marrick 1807; a general agent at 78½
Wood st. Cheapside, London 1834–48; a breeder of race horses at
Dalston 1848, at Middle park near Eltham 1852 to death; his
breeding stud gradually became the largest in England; held his
first sale of blood stock at Middle park June 1856, held two
annual sales there 1867 to death; bred Hermit winner of the Derby
1867, and Gamos winner of the Oaks 1870; gave 5000 guineas for
Blink Bonny, 5000 guineas for Blair Athol, and 5800 guineas for
Gladiateur; founded the great two year old race at Newmarket,
namely The Middle Park Plate 1866. _d._ Middle Park 25 Sep. 1871
in 64 year. _Rice’s History of the British turf ii_, 338–44
(1879); _Gent. Mag. iii_, 451–62 (1869); _I.L.N. lix_, 377 (1871),
_portrait_; _Illust. sporting and dramatic news i_, 181 (1874),
_portrait_; _Sporting life 27 Sep. 1871_, _p._ 2, _cols._ 1, 5, 4
_Oct._ _p._ 2, _col._ 6.
